When can I register for the Science PhD Day?

Registration will open early March. You will receive an e-mail when registration opens.

Who can register for the Science PhD Day?

All PhD candidates enrolled in the Leiden University Graduate School of Science can participate in the PhD Day.

How do I register for the Science PhD Day?

You can register via the "Registration" link in the menu to the left, or with the link you received in the invitation. Registration will open early March.

Is there a registration fee?

The Science PhD Day is free of charge for PhD candidates of the Leiden University Faculty of Science.

Can I take part in part of the day?

You are free to participate for however long you think is useful to you. Make sure you register for the parts you would like to participate in, as the number of spots available is limited.

How should I prepare for the Science PhD Day

For all workshops you will take part in, you can read up on the teacher for the workshop. Furthermore, some workshops require you to do some home preparations. This will be indicated in the information about the workshop, or will be communicated to you via email.

Can I earn any credits?

Participating in the Science PhD Day counts towards the 140 hours of activities focusing on transferable skills that employed and contract PhD candidates are expected to follow according to the Leiden University PhD guidelines.

You can earn up to a maximum of 8 hours if you attend the full-day programme. Your will receive a certificate of participation after the Science PhD Day for registration in LUCRIS GSM.
